js之 for循环 普通for 循环 语法 for ([initialization]; [condition]; [final-expression]) statement initialization 一个表达式 (包含赋值语句) 或者变量声明。典型地被用于初始化一个计数器。该表达式可以使用var关键字声明新的变量。初始化中的变量不是该循环的局部变量,而是与for循环处在同样的作用域中。该...
var num = 1;//1、声明循环变量let obj={‘name’:‘programmer’,‘age’:‘22’,‘height’:‘180’}; for(let i in obj){ console.log(i,obj[i]) } while (num<10){//2、判断循环条件; console.log(num);//3、执行循环体操作; num++;//4、更新循环变量; }三...
1.for有三个表达式: 声明环境变量; 判断循环的条件; 更新循环变量; 2.for循环执行的特点: 先判断在执行; 这三个表达式有多重身份组成,第二个判断条件用&& 或||连接 for(var i = 0 ; i <10 ; i++){ console.log(i);// 0 1 2 3 4 5 6 7 8 9 10 } 1. 2. 3. 2.while循环 循环特点:...
每次迭代操作会同时搜索实例或者原型属性, for-in 循环的每次迭代都会产生更多开销,因此要比其他循环类型慢,一般速度为其他类型循环的 1/7。因此,除非明确需要迭代一个属性数量未知的对象,否则应避免使用 for-in 循环。如果需要遍历一个数量有限的已知属性列表,使用其他循环会更快,比如下面的例子: const obj = { "...
for 循环在平时开发中使用频率最高的,前后端数据交互时,常见的数据类型就是数组和对象,处理对象和数组时经常使用到 for 遍历,因此需要彻底搞懂这 5 种 for 循环。它们分别为: for for ... in for ... of for await .. of forEach map 一、各个 for 介绍 ...
js for循环的几种写法 JavaScript中有多种方式可以实现循环,以下是其中几种常用的方式: 1. for循环: for (var i = 0; i < 5; i++) { console.log(i); } 2. while循环: var i = 0; while (i < 5) { console.log(i); i++; } 3. do-while循环: var i = 0; do { console.log(i...
JS中for循环的四种写法⽰例(⼊门级)⽬录 1. 传统for循环 2. for of 循环 3. for in 循环 4. forEach⽅法 附完整实例:总结 1. 传统for循环 for (init; cond; inc) { // body } 与C++或Java类似,for关键字后⽤⼩括号描述循环设置,在⼩括号中⽤两个分号;将循环设置隔断为三个部分...
JS for 循环 JavaScript 中几种 for 循环的方式 1. for vararr=newArray(1,2,4);for(varj=0;j<arr.length;j++){console.log('结果'+arr[j]);}/* 结果1 结果2 结果4 */ 2. for ... in ... vararr=newArray(1,2,4);for(variinarr){console.log('元素'+arr[i]);}/*...
for(语句1;语句2;语句3){ 执行代码; } 在上面语句在, 在for后面的括号中,有三条语句,分别用分号隔开。一般我们会这样写 for(var i=0;i<=10;i++){} 我们可以看到,第一条语句,使用了一个赋值表答式。他是在进入循环前先定议了一个变量i让他一开始等于0 ,最后一条语句是i++;,其实我们在写while循...
一句话概括:for in是遍历(object)键名,for of是遍历(array)键值——for of 循环用来获取一对键值对中的值,而 for in 获取的是 键名。 for in 循环出的是key(并且key的类型是string),for of 循环出的是value。 for of 是es6引新引入的特性,修复了es5引入的for in 的不足。